The director, [[Jon Favreau]], reprises his role as [[Happy Hogan (comics)|Happy Hogan]],<ref name="FavreauHappyTwitter" /> Tony Stark's bodyguard and chauffeur, while [[Clark Gregg]] and [[Leslie Bibb]] reprise their roles as S.H.I.E.L.D. Agent [[Phil Coulson]]<ref name="GreggMara" /> and reporter [[Christine Everhart]],<ref name="BibbEverhart" /> respectively. [[John Slattery]] appears as Tony's father Howard Stark<ref name="SlatteryHoward" /> and [[Garry Shandling]] appears as United States Senator Stern, who wants Stark to give Iron Man's armor to the government.<ref name="Shandling" /> Favreau stated that Shandling's character was named after radio personality [[Howard Stern]].<ref name="BabaBooey" /> [[Paul Bettany]] again voices Stark's computer, [[Edwin Jarvis#J.A.R.V.I.S.|J.A.R.V.I.S.]]<ref name="BettanyJARVIS" /> [[Olivia Munn]] has a small role as Chess Roberts, a reporter covering the Stark expo,<ref name="MunnImprov" /><ref name="MunnChange" /> [[Yevgeni Lazarev]] appears as Ivan Vanko's father [[Anton Vanko]],<ref name="Lazarev" /> [[Kate Mara]] portrays a U.S. Marshal who summons Tony to the government hearing,<ref name="Mara" /> and [[Stan Lee]] appears as himself (but is mistaken for [[Larry King]]).<ref name="LeeKing" />
 
Additionally, news anchor [[Christiane Amanpour]]<ref name="Amanpour" /> and political commentator [[Bill O'Reilly (political commentator)|Bill O'Reilly]]<ref name="VarietyReview" /> play themselves in newscasts. [[Adam Goldstein]] appears as himself and the film is dedicated to his memory.<ref name=commentary /> Further cameos include [[Tesla Motors]] CEO [[Elon Musk]] and [[Oracle Corporation]] CEO [[Larry Ellison]].<ref name="MuskEllisonCameos" /> Favreau's son Max appears as a child wearing an Iron Man mask whom Stark saves from a drone. This was [[retcon|retroactively]] made the introduction of a young [[Spider-Man|Peter Parker]] to the MCU, as confirmed in June 2017 by eventual Spider-Man actor [[Tom Holland (actor)|Tom Holland]], Feige and ''[[Spider-Man: Homecoming]]'' director [[Jon Watts]].<ref name="PeterParker" /><ref name="PeterParker2" />
